Publisher Description

Cook like a Grandma takes a new approach to recipe design — first laying out the basics required for general braising, pastas, soup, salad, and omelettes. Recipe instruction comes to life in embedded videos, where restaurateur Maria Flawia Litwin invites you into her kitchen to witness succinct how-to for each category. 

Chapters on managing old bread, learning to love cabbage, and crusts for rustic tarts expose the internal logic of a kitchen. After establishing the basics, Maria shares her finest recipes. Cook like a Grandma reaches beyond your average recipe-book with chapters on smart kitchen cleaning as well as savvy shop, stock, and ingredient rotation.

Maria Flawia Litwin is a visual artist and the co-owner of popular Toronto restaurant La Palette. The beauty in Maria’s preparation stems from spending her formative years around international cuisines — from Poland to Australia to France and finally Canada. Her years as a restauranteur become evident in her relatable and sustainable cooking advice.

Cook like a Grandma is like a gym membership,” Maria says. “It gives you the tools to enhance your skills, but you’re not going to get a six-pack right away.”

Maria’s kitchen style is thrifty, recombining what’s already stocked in the fridge and pantry. Her menu creation tips often encourage reliance on local, in-season ingredients. With curiosity, common sense, and trial-by-error, Maria shirks most measurements and guides her readers towards ages-old kitchen know-how. You'll find food prep, pantry-stocking, and meal designs for all diets in Cook like a Grandma.
